**Two-layer architecture:**

1. **Tree-sitter pass** — fast, syntactic, runs for every one of the 162 languages. Extracts definitions, calls, imports.
1. **Tree-sitter pass** — fast, syntactic, runs for every one of the 163 languages. Extracts definitions, calls, imports.
2. **Hybrid LSP pass** — type-aware, runs above the tree-sitter pass per-language. Refines call edges using the import graph plus a per-file or pre-built cross-file definition registry. Languages without a Hybrid LSP pass yet fall back to textual resolution, so you always get *some* answer.

The result is a knowledge graph accurate enough to drive `trace_path` across packages, inheritance hierarchies, and stdlib calls — without paying for a language server process per project.
